## Who to Contact — Garage Occupancy Feed

The Stallcount feed publishes occupancy for the Birchyard garages every 90 seconds. Sensor outages are owned by the Facilities Data team; ingestion bugs belong to the Kerbside platform crew. Check the feed status page before escalating, since most gaps are planned sensor maintenance. For anything unclear, email the feed owners directly below.

escalation mailbox, fafof-bahip: tamael@ordincorp.test

**Action item (INC follow-up): Varrow Assign service**

Sticky assignments expired early during the outage, so some users flipped experiment arms mid-session. Support: if customers report inconsistent features, check assignment timestamps before escalating. Fix shipped; TTLs and cache bounds were retuned to prevent recurrence. Do not manually reassign users. Escalate only if flips persist past the new TTL window. Revised constants are listed below.

tuning table, yaweg-kajef:
WEIGHTS = {
    "ralwyn": 573,
    "praius": 56,
    "eliok": 19,
}

**Runbook: Donation-receipt mailer (Willowgate)**

If receipts stop sending: check the Larkspur queue depth first. Over 500 means the renderer is stuck — restart the mailer pod, not the queue. Receipts are idempotent; re-sending is safe. Never purge the queue manually. After restart, verify one receipt end-to-end in staging. Confirm the running deploy matches the build token recorded below.

build token for kajeg-bageg: htk6_abeb3e

Subject: Build agent clock skew — cut-over complete

Cut-over finished 03:10. All Foundry build agents now sync against the internal Chronoline tier instead of per-agent local sources. Skew between agents dropped from ~9s worst case to under 120ms. Signed artifact timestamps are now trustworthy again; the two builds flagged last week were skew artifacts, not tampering. Old NTP config removed from agent images. For your review, each agent now boots with the following time-sync configuration:

deployment values, taweg-bajop:
[fenvan]
port = 5672
team = holmir
host = fenvan.orvexio.example
region = lower-1
access_code = ac_b98bc6
timeout_ms = 1500